The architectural diversity of the residential area, featuring traditional mid century brick veneer homes, extensive household homes, and modern townhouses, requires a highly versatile approach to pest detection. Different building and construction methods present unique vulnerability points. For example, older homes typically include standard wood floorboards and subflooring that sit near to damp soil, providing simple access routes for foraging pests. Newer structures built on concrete pieces deal with dangers from pests breaching border seals or going into through utility pipeline penetrations. Seasoned local inspectors comprehend these particular structural subtleties and customize their search parameters to target the exact weak spots of each unique residential or commercial property layout.

Ecological obligation is also a crucial factor to consider for modern-day families living throughout the area. Modern pest management practices have actually progressed substantially, moving away from extreme, blanket chemical treatments of the past. Today, local inspectors concentrate on targeted baiting systems, physical barriers, and eco friendly deterrents that securely secure the home without positioning risks to local wildlife, family pets, or the surrounding ecosystem.
